Mark Handforth

'Drop Shadow' book exhibition - October 2014.

Mark Handforth, worthy heir of the Pop Art movement, is known for his sculptures diverting everyday objects and urban furniture.

Benches, lamp posts, signposts, vespas are thus re-presented, extracted from their original context and reinjected in a playful way in exhibition spaces or in the public space. Light is omnipresent in his work. Fluorescent light, candlelight, city light...

Guido Mocafico 

Book for the 'Mocafico Numéro' Exhibition.

Established fashion photographer, Mocafico composes radical still lifes out of objects like perfume bottles, shoes, watches and jewelry for Numéro, shooting in ways that incorporate the conventions of architecture, landscape and nude photography.

Mocafico’s work for Numéro provides a model for creative experimentation in the genre.
